WebSiding repair contractors can use the following as guidance when repairing butt joints that were not spaced correctly and may be causing LP ® SmartSide ® Lap Siding to buckle. When installed, all ends and butt joints should be spaced a minimum of 3/16″. For a quick reference, w atch our expert demonstrating this repair process. WebFeb 20, 2024 · Measure and cut to length the first piece of siding and nail it in place (Photo 7). Leave a 1/8-in. gap where the end meets the corner board (Photo 7, inset) and make sure the other end lands on a stud line. Install the next piece so its end butts lightly against the first (Photo 7, inset).
